Faucet Repair in Denver, CO
Faucet repair services address issues related to leaky, faulty, or malfunctioning faucets in residential properties. These projects typically include fixing leaks, replacing worn-out washers or cartridges, repairing dripping spouts, and restoring proper water flow. Homeowners often seek these services when experiencing persistent dripping sounds, increased water bills due to leaks, or difficulty operating the faucet. Understanding the type of faucet (such as compression, cartridge, ball, or ceramic disk) and the specific problem can help property owners communicate their needs effectively before requesting repairs.
Before requesting faucet repair, property owners should consider the age and type of their existing fixtures, as well as any symptoms observed, such as water pooling or unusual noises. It’s helpful to know if the faucet is still under warranty or if parts need to be replaced entirely. Clarifying whether the goal is to repair or replace the faucet can ensure the right service is provided. Proper identification of the issue and the fixture details can facilitate a smoother repair process and help determine the best solution for restoring proper function and preventing future problems.

Faucet Repair Questions
What are common signs of a faucet needing repair? Dripping sounds, low water pressure, or water pooling around the base are typical indicators.
Can a leaking faucet waste a lot of water? Yes, continuous leaks can lead to significant water waste over time.
Is it possible to fix a faucet without replacing it? Many minor issues, like worn washers or loose parts, can be repaired without replacing the entire faucet.
What types of faucet repairs are frequently requested? Repairs often involve fixing leaks, replacing cartridges, or addressing handle issues.
